The Day-to-Day Benefits of a Five-Bedroom Home
One of the clearest benefits of a five-bedroom home is flexibility. Smaller layouts can start to feel tight as family routines change and children need more privacy. Five bedrooms can comfortably cover children’s rooms, a guest room, and extra space for work or study.
This added room can make the home easier to live in over time. One room might serve as a home office now and a guest room later. When remote working is common, a quiet room for work can help create a better divide between personal and professional time. Instead of using a shared room as a makeshift office, families can keep communal spaces clear.
How Smart Technology Fits Into Modern Family Homes
Modern five-bedroom developments in Blackburn often include smart systems that help with comfort and security. Doorbell systems like Ring make it possible to view and speak to visitors using a smartphone. Families may find this helpful for parcel drop-offs, visitor management, and added reassurance when away from home.
Remote heating controls are also popular with buyers of newer homes. Instead of setting heating only at the wall unit, homeowners can often control it from their phone. That can reduce wasted heating during empty parts of the day. It also allows timed settings and pre-arrival adjustments, which may help with running costs over time.

What Makes Blackburn Appealing to Buyers
Blackburn remains a popular choice for buyers seeking accessibility and relative value within Lancashire. Property can still appear more accessible here than in some larger nearby cities, while everyday infrastructure remains strong.
- Straightforward road access through the M65 corridor
- Rail connections to places such as Manchester and Preston
- Access to open spaces and countryside
- Useful local services for family life
